Local Government Ministry Launches Cleanup Campaign, #WeCleanTT

As the Ministry of Rural Development and Local Government launches a national clean-up and rainy season preparedness campaign, WeCleanTT, recently installed Minister Faris Al Rawi is seeking to highlight the importance of such a venture.

The WeCleanTT campaign, which will span across Trinidad and Tobago, is geared towards cleaning and assessing the conditions of the country’s roadways, embankments, vacant lots, recreational grounds and markets among other areas as well as the removal of derelict vehicles.

Speaking on Power 102 Digital’s Power Breakfast Show on Tuesday, Minister Al Rawi shared that the campaign will also serve as a surveying exercise to commence data driven action on road repairs and maintenance.

The first stop of the campaign is Diego Martin Regional Corporation on Sat April 23rd and Sun April 24th, Minister Al Rawi urged the participation of residents.

Residents are asked to send photos and pin locations of old appliances, derelict cars, tree cuttings and other debris in their community, via whats-app only to 707-9122 / 707- 9130
